Decoding Sign-Up Offers: What They Really Mean
The flashy “100% match up to $500” isn’t free money; it’s a locked contract. When you decode this offer, the fine print reveals a 30x wagering requirement on the bonus plus deposit, meaning you must bet $15,000 before withdrawing a cent. Slots contribute 100%, but blackjack might only count 10%, steering your play. A friend once chased such a bonus, only to find his $50 winnings trapped behind a 45-day expiry—the real sign-up reward is often a test of patience, not luck. Always check game restrictions and max bet limits, or the bonus becomes a leash.

Wagering Requirements: The Fine Print That Matters
Wagering requirements dictate how many times you must play through a casino bonus before withdrawing any winnings. A common trap is misreading the fine print: a 35x requirement on the bonus amount is far more achievable than 35x on the bonus plus deposit. Games like slots often contribute 100% toward meeting these conditions, while blackjack or roulette may count for only 10% or even zero, drastically slowing progress. Always check the maximum bet allowed while wagering; exceeding it can void your bonus. The time limit to complete wagering is another critical detail—miss it, and your bonus and winnings are forfeit. Prioritize bonuses with low wagering multipliers and high game contribution rates to turn fine print into real value.
How to Calculate Playthrough Before You Accept
Before you click “Accept,” grab the bonus terms and find the playthrough requirements. First, note the bonus amount and the multiplier (e.g., 35x). Multiply them together: a $100 bonus at 35x means $3,500 in wagers. Next, check if your deposit counts; if so, add it to the bonus before multiplying. Then, identify which games count 100% toward wagering—slots usually do, but blackjack might only contribute 10%. Finally, divide your total playthrough by your average bet size to estimate how many spins or hands you’ll need. This math reveals if the offer is worth your time.

Game Weighting and Why Slots Help You Clear Faster
Game weighting determines how much of your bet counts toward wagering requirements. Slots usually contribute 100%, meaning every dollar you spin reduces the playthrough dollar-for-dollar. Table games and video poker often contribute far less—sometimes only 10% or 20%—making them much slower to clear. To maximize speed, always focus on slots with 100% weighting. Slots help you clear faster because they avoid the penalty of reduced contribution. Follow this sequence:
- Check the bonus terms for each game’s contribution percentage.
- Identify slots listed at 100% weighting.
- Play only those slots until the wagering requirement is met.

Earning Rates per Wager and Tier Advancement
Earning rates per wager vary by game, with slots often granting one point per $10 wagered, while table games may require $50 for the same point. Tier advancement depends on accumulating base points, not redeemable comps, where higher tiers unlock accelerated earning multipliers. Strategic players focus on high-point games during double-point promotions to expedite status progression. This efficiency directly impacts the speed of unlocking faster point accumulation and better comp conversion ratios at elite levels.
Earning rates per wager dictate point generation, while tier advancement requires base point thresholds to unlock multiplier boosts for subsequent wagers.
